reachability

¿Cómo comprobar si hay una conexión a Internet activa en iOS o macOS?

Me gustaría comprobar si tengo una conexión a Internet en iOS usando las bibliotecas Cocoa Touch o en macOS usando las bibli ... ar que stringWithContentsOfURL está en desuso en iOS 3.0 y macOS 10.4) y si es así, ¿cuál es una mejor manera de lograr esto?

La forma más fácil de detectar la conexión a Internet en iOS?

Sé que esta pregunta parecerá ser un engaño de muchos otros, sin embargo, no siento que el caso simple esté bien explicado aq ... citud o no. Idealmente no requiere ninguna configuración y solo devuelve un booleano. ¿Esto realmente no es posible en iOS?

iOS Detecta 3G o WiFi

No estoy seguro de si esto es posible, pero tengo este escenario. Tengo un sitio web mostrado en mi UIWebView que tiene el e ... spuesta ir al segmento 1 o 2 Algo así: if (iPhone device is on 3g) { Go to Segment 1; } else { Go to Segment 0; }

Comprobación de accesibilidad del iPhone

He encontrado varios ejemplos de código para hacer lo que quiero (comprobar la accesibilidad), pero ninguno de ellos parece s ... de "solo use las cosas si las necesita absolutamente" también. Aquí está el enlace de iTunes a la aplicación, EvoScanner.